Hello friends, I understand some are still confused about the lockdown starting Monday and whether it will impact health care services. Just a reminder that we are OPEN all of next week December 21-24th. Then closing for 1 week starting Christmas Day for holidays (not because of a lockdown).... Regulated health professionals which includes chiropractors are allowed to operate under the provincial framework. Please note that we never relaxed the lockdown measures at Tree of Life Chiropractic since opening in June. We have been voluntarily operating within a lockdown framework for everyone’s safety even when we could admit more people. As you can see, for good reason. We will remain open and continue serving our practice members safely through these difficult times. Health care is essential. Always. Dr Nenos

Dear patients: Whether it's RED ZONE, yellow zone, or grey zone. Unless our office specifically calls you to tell you otherwise we are OPEN. The city did a terrible job of explaining to its citizens what the colour zones all mean. You’ll be surprised to learn that almost everything is still open and they are just asking everyone to limit crowded places to 10 people. Tree of Life Chiropractic is not one of those places. Each patient has a designated time slot and we have 1 way traffic in the building. Contact is VERY limited. Except of course with me . Health care is essential never forget it.
